Pre-Commit Quality Checker
Purpose
Automated quality gate that runs before committing code to catch issues early:
- TypeScript compilation errors
- Database migration conflicts
- Console.log statements in production code
- TODOs without issue references
- Hardcoded secrets or API keys
- Missing tests for new service functions
Auto-Invocation Triggers
This skill activates when:
- User asks to "commit changes" or "create a commit"
- User mentions "pre-commit" or "commit check"
- Before creating a pull request
- User runs git commit (via hook)
Comprehensive Check List
1. TypeScript Compilation
npm run check
- ✅ All TypeScript files compile without errors
- ✅ No type errors in modified files
- ❌ Fail if compilation errors exist
2. Database Migration Safety
- ✅ Check for migration conflicts in
drizzle/meta/ - ✅ Ensure sequential migration numbering
- ✅ No uncommitted schema changes
- ❌ Flag if schema.ts modified but no migration generated
3. Code Quality Checks
Console.log Detection:
grep -r "console\.log" server/ client/src/ --exclude-dir=node_modules
- ⚠️ Flag console.log in
server/(production code) - ⚠️ Flag console.log in
client/src/except debug files - ✅ Allow in test files and dev utilities
TODO Comments:
grep -rn "TODO" server/ client/src/ --exclude-dir=node_modules
- ✅ All TODOs have issue references:
TODO(#123): description - ❌ Fail if TODO without issue number
- Format:
TODO(#issue): what needs to be done
4. Security Checks
Hardcoded Secrets: Search for common patterns:
API_KEY = "SECRET = "PASSWORD = "TOKEN = ".envfiles in git (should be ignored)
Sensitive Files:
- ❌ No
.envfiles committed - ❌ No
credentials.jsonor similar - ❌ No private keys (
.pem,.key)
5. Test Coverage (New Services)
- Check if new files in
server/services/have corresponding tests - Flag service functions without test coverage
- Suggest test file creation
6. Import/Export Consistency
- ✅ No unused imports (TypeScript will catch this)
- ✅ No circular dependencies
- ✅ Consistent import paths (relative vs absolute)

Bypass Options
When to Allow Bypass
- Work-in-progress commits on feature branches
- Emergency hotfixes (with approval)
- Refactoring commits (with team awareness)
How to Bypass
Add flag to commit message:
git commit -m "WIP: Feature development [skip-checks]"
Note: Main branch should NEVER allow bypass
Standards
Critical (MUST FIX)
- ❌ TypeScript compilation errors
- ❌ Migration conflicts
- ❌ Hardcoded secrets in committed files
- ❌ .env files in git
Warnings (SHOULD FIX)
- ⚠️ console.log in production code
- ⚠️ TODOs without issue references
- ⚠️ New services without tests
- ⚠️ Potential secrets (false positives allowed)
Informational (NICE TO FIX)
- ℹ️ Code complexity warnings
- ℹ️ Import organization suggestions
- ℹ️ Documentation gaps
Integration
Git Hooks (Recommended)
Add to .husky/pre-commit:
#!/bin/sh
echo "Running pre-commit checks..."
npm run check || exit 1
# Add other checks here
CI/CD Integration
Add to GitHub Actions:
- name: Pre-commit checks
run: |
npm run check
npm run lint
npm run test

Configuration
Skip Files/Directories
Default skip list:
node_modules/dist/,build/.next/,out/coverage/*.test.ts,*.spec.ts(for console.log check)client/src/debug/(for console.log check)
Custom Patterns
Add to .claude/settings.json:
{
"skills": {
"pre-commit-checker": {
"skipConsoleLogs": ["client/src/debug/", "scripts/"],
"requiredTodoFormat": "TODO\\(#\\d+\\)",
"allowedSecretPatterns": ["PUBLIC_API_KEY"]
}
}
}
